HSC § 118147

Notwithstanding any other provision of this chapter, a registered medical waste generator, which is a facility specified in subdivisions (a) and (b) of Section 117705, may accept home-generated sharps waste, to be consolidated with the facility’s medical waste stream, subject to all of the following conditions:
(a) The generator of the sharps waste, a member of the generator’s family, or a person authorized by the enforcement agency transports the sharps waste to the medical waste generator’s facility.
(b) The sharps waste is accepted at a central location at the medical waste generator’s facility.
(c) A reference to, and a description of, the actions taken pursuant to this section are included in the facility’s medical waste management plan adopted pursuant to Section 117960.
